The Vande Mataram Bill, officially known as the Prevention of Insults to National Honour (Amendment) Bill, 2026, is a significant piece of legislation passed by the Rajya Sabha in 2026 359. Its primary purpose is to grant "Vande Mataram," India's national song, the same legal protection that is currently afforded to the national anthem 37.
Historical Context of Vande Mataram
"Vande Mataram" is a poem written in Sanskritised Bengali by Bankim Chandra Chatterjee in the 1870s 1. It was first published in 1882 as part of Chatterjee's Bengali novel Anandmath 1. In 1950, it was adopted as the national song of the Republic of India 1. The song has a long history of political and constitutional debate, predating India's independence 4.
Key Provisions of the Vande Mataram Bill 2026
The Vande Mataram Bill 2026 introduces several key changes and provisions:
- Equal Legal Protection: The most crucial aspect of the bill is that it elevates the legal status of "Vande Mataram" to be on par with the national anthem 379. This means that acts of disrespect or obstruction towards the national song will now carry similar legal consequences as those directed at the national anthem.
- Punishable Offence: The bill makes the deliberate insult of "Vande Mataram" or the intentional obstruction of its rendition a punishable offence 210. This includes causing a disturbance to any assembly engaged in singing or playing the national song 3.
- Penalties: Individuals found guilty under this new law could face imprisonment of up to three years, a fine, or both 910.
Implications and Debate
The passing of the Vande Mataram Bill 2026 has reignited a long-standing debate surrounding the national song 4. While proponents argue that it provides necessary protection for a symbol of national pride, critics raise concerns about potential implications for individual freedoms and the possibility of forced rendition 4. The bill aims to ensure that the national song, a significant part of India's cultural and historical fabric, receives due respect and is safeguarded against intentional dishonor 68.
